Because of the MaximoWorld conference at the top of the month, this was a very exciting month for Cohesive Solutions, and one team member, Stephen Miller. For the first time at the conference, MaximoWorld leaders recognized extraordinary achievements and team accomplishments in the Maximo community for practitioners and vendors. Cohesive Solutions is proud to be the Best New Implementation award recipient of ReliabilityWeb's 2019 award program. This award was accepted by Stephen, our Practice Leader of Energy and Utilities. He is this month’s August spotlight.

Briefly describe what you do in a day.

I have a concentrated focus on Oil and Gas Pipeline EAM improvement programs. I work hands-on with clients to ensure that the business processes they are following are both effective and efficient for how they uniquely operate to safeguard that the systems they use are configured to facilitate these processes. What’s the best thing about your job?

I enjoy helping clients move up the maintenance maturity curve and seeing the result of our efforts have a positive impact on the people in the field. Understanding these changes are what makes it worth all the effort.

What do you like to do when you’re not at the office?

My passion outside of work is around my family and racing, and we mix it too!  I've been a part of the SCCA (Sports Car Club of America) for around 20 years, and active on the operations part for nearly five years.  I operate the Junior Driver Development program for both North and South Carolina regions, Chair the Time Trial program for North Carolina, and am on the South Carolina Region Board of Directors.

What inspires you?

The opportunity to make a difference in how companies operate and ultimately impact the day-to-day work of so many people.  It is a fantastic feeling to go into work every day knowing WHAT you're going to do, and yet so many organizations are so reactive their workforce has never experienced that.  Being able to bring that experience to the table and the ability to guide them from where they are now to where they can be that is what drives me to do what I do.
